The Ministry of Economy has identified priority areas for 2017 year

The mechanism for achieving goals in these areas will be project management.

The Project Office for the implementation of the Strategy of Socio-economic Development of the Omsk region continues its work. In accordance with the tasks assigned to it, five main stages of its work have been identified, two of which have already been completed.: "Assessment of the preliminary results of the Strategy implementation" and "Analysis "problematic sectors" and the directions of development". To date, the Project Office is in the process of developing a mechanism for its implementation, which is becoming project management.

In December 2016 Regulatory legal acts regulating the activities of the Government of the Omsk region within the framework of project management were approved. According to the accepted documents, the project will be implemented by a project team, which is formed from government officials who perform certain roles in the project, and each department will have its own project office. Projects can be priority, internal and external. At the same time, all projects should be closely linked to the Socio-Economic Development Strategy in terms of their goals and objectives, and regardless of their level, they will become tools for its implementation.

The Ministry of Economy is completing the stage of forming priority projects aimed at growing the competitive economy of the Omsk region. Total of such projects 15. Some of the projects are the tasks set by the Governor of the Omsk region, Viktor Nazarov, in the budget message to 2017 year.

Thus, the Ministry of Economy has identified the following areas of work as priorities:

- "Implementation of the Project Office for the implementation of the Strategy of socio-economic development of the Omsk region to 2025 years",

- "Improving the social nutrition system in the Omsk region",

- "Construction of educational facilities based on the conclusion of a state contract and a mechanism of public-private partnership",

- "Creation of an industrial park "Sunny",

- "Implementation of the assessment system of the OMS to promote competition and ensure conditions for a favorable investment climate",

- "Introduction and implementation of the procedure for interaction of the executive authorities of the Omsk region to improve the position of the Omsk region in the assessments (ratings) of the subjects of the Russian Federation",

- "Ensuring the attraction and effective use of federal budget funds in 2017 year",

- "Implementation of a system for evaluating the effectiveness of industrial cluster development in the Omsk region",

- "Integrated development of the single-industry town of Krasnoyarsk urban settlement of Lyubinsky district of Omsk region",

- "Improvement of control and supervisory activities",

- "Development of Business-MFC activities",

- "Small business and support for individual entrepreneurial initiatives",

- "International cooperation and export",

- "Implementation of performance assessment of employees of the Ministry of Economy".
